Automorphic Integral Transforms for Classical Groups I: Endoscopy Correspondences
Abstract
A general framework of constructions of endoscopy correspondences via automorphic integral transforms for classical groups is formulated in terms of the Arthur classification of the discrete spectrum of square-integrable automorphic forms. This suggests a principle, which is called the (τ,b)-theory of automorphic forms of classical groups, to reorganize and extend the series of work of Piatetski-Shapiro, Rallis, Kudla and others on standard L-functions of classical groups and theta correspondence.
